Months ago, Bollywood actor Sushant Singh Rajput allegedly killed himself by suicide and the probe in his case opened many secrets of the Bollywood industry. With an unexpected turn of a drug angle coming forward, many renowned Bollywood celebrities came under the radar of NCB. While earlier actress like Deepika Padukone, Sara Ali Khan and Shraddha Kapoor were summoned by the agency, the report suggests that now male actors are in the list.

As per a source close to the investigation, Deepika Padukone’s co-actors are likely to be summoned by the NCB next in links with the ongoing drug probe. While the developments are kept under tight wraps, the source reveals that the co-actors of Deepika Padukone who are under the NCB scanner have the initials ‘A’, ‘R’, and ‘S’. These names are given by former Dharmatic Entertainment employee Kshitij Prasad during his interrogation with NCB. The report also suggests that the actor with initial ‘A’ not only procured contraband substances but also smuggled them.

Meanwhile, Kshitij has been kept under judicial custody for further investigation and actresses who were summoned earlier are not given a clean chit either. As per the reports, cellphones of Deepika Padukone, Sara Ali Khan, Shraddha Kapoor and Rakul Preet Singh are seized by NCB for probe while their financial transactions are being studied. On the other hand, NCB has opposed the bail plea of Rhea Chakraborty and her brother.
